1. What Makes Asti, Piedmont a Unique Tourist Destination?
Asti, a town nestled in the Piedmont region of Italy, offers tourists a unique experience rooted in its rich historical background and vibrant cultural scene. Once a bustling commercial center founded by the Romans, Asti now provides a peaceful yet captivating atmosphere. It’s not just a stopover; it’s a destination filled with art, history, and local traditions. According to research from the Italian National Tourist Board (ENIT), in 2023, Piedmont saw a 15% increase in tourism revenue, highlighting the growing interest in the region’s unique offerings.
The town boasts a heritage that stretches back to Roman times, evidenced by landmarks like the Red Tower, a relic of the ancient city walls. Throughout the centuries, Asti has been a crucial point for travelers and traders, bridging France and Milan. This diverse history is palpable as you wander through the streets. The annual Palio horse race, which predates Siena’s famous event, showcases Asti’s vibrant traditions. Exploring the Jewish Ghetto, one of Europe’s last established, reveals stories of prominent families who shaped the city’s urban landscape. Asti’s unique blend of historical depth, cultural vibrancy, and artistic treasures make it an unmissable Italian destination.
2. What Historical Sites Should I Visit on an Asti Tour?
An Asti tour should include several key historical sites that narrate the city’s vibrant past. The Red Tower (Torre Rossa), a remnant of the Roman era, stands as a testament to Asti’s ancient origins. According to archaeological studies conducted by the University of Turin in 2018, the Torre Rossa dates back to the 1st century AD and was an integral part of the city’s defenses.
The Asti Cathedral, the largest Gothic church in Piedmont, showcases the city’s medieval power and wealth. The San Secondo Church, dedicated to Asti’s patron saint, is a beautiful example of Romanesque architecture that has stood since the 10th century. Don’t miss the Troyana Tower, the tallest medieval tower in Asti, offering panoramic views of the city. A visit to the Jewish Ghetto provides insight into the community’s historical impact on Asti. Lastly, San Pietro in Consavia, designed to replicate the Holy Sepulcher in Jerusalem, offers a glimpse into the religious fervor of the Middle Ages. Each site tells a part of Asti’s story, from its Roman beginnings to its medieval glory.

4. What are the Best Food and Wine Experiences in Asti Piedmont?
Asti Piedmont offers an array of food and wine experiences that highlight the region’s culinary excellence. Wine tasting is a must, with Asti being famous for its Asti Spumante. Local wineries provide tours and tastings where you can learn about the production process and sample various vintages.
Food tours offer a chance to taste regional specialties such as truffle-infused dishes, handmade pasta, and local cheeses. Cooking classes will teach you how to prepare traditional Piedmontese dishes. Visiting local agriturismi (farm-to-table restaurants) allows you to enjoy fresh, seasonal ingredients in a rustic setting. Don’t miss the opportunity to dine at Michelin-starred restaurants like Guido Ristorante, which showcase the region’s innovative cuisine. Pairing local wines with regional dishes, such as Barbera d’Asti with brasato al Barolo (beef braised in Barolo wine), enhances the culinary experience. According to Gambero Rosso, a leading Italian food and wine guide, Piedmont is consistently ranked among Italy’s top culinary regions. These food and wine experiences provide a comprehensive taste of Asti’s gastronomic delights.
5. Are There Any Hidden Gems or Lesser-Known Attractions in Asti?
Asti has many hidden gems and lesser-known attractions that offer unique experiences beyond the typical tourist trail. The Crypt of Sant’Anastasio, an intriguing 8th-century crypt, provides a glimpse into Asti’s early religious history.
The Fossil Museum, showcasing a complete whale skeleton and dolphins, is a fascinating attraction, especially for families. Exploring the Romanesque churches scattered throughout the countryside, such as San Secondo in Cortazzone, reveals architectural and artistic treasures. The Abbey of Vezzolano, located just outside Albugnano, is a significant monastic center with a beautiful cloister. Visiting the quaint village of Viatosto, with its Romanesque-Gothic church, offers panoramic views of the area. Discovering local artisans and workshops, where traditional crafts are still practiced, provides insight into Asti’s cultural heritage. These hidden gems offer unique perspectives on Asti’s history, art, and natural beauty.

12. What Events and Festivals Should I Consider Attending in Asti?
Asti hosts several events and festivals throughout the year that showcase the region’s culture, cuisine, and traditions. Here are some notable events to consider attending:
Event | Month | Description |
---|---|---|
Palio di Asti | September | Historic horse race with colorful costumes and pageantry. |
Festival delle Sagre | September | Food festival celebrating local cuisine and regional specialties. |
Alba White Truffle Festival | October-November | Festival dedicated to the famous white truffles of Alba, featuring truffle markets and culinary events. |
Douja d’Or | September | Wine festival showcasing local wines and winemaking traditions. |
Christmas Markets | December | Festive markets with local crafts, food, and holiday cheer. |
According to event calendars from the Asti Tourist Office, these festivals offer unique cultural experiences and opportunities to immerse yourself in local traditions. Check the dates and plan your visit accordingly to make the most of these events.

16. What Are Some Popular Walking Routes in Asti?
Asti offers several popular walking routes that allow you to explore the city’s historical and cultural highlights. Here are some suggested routes:
- Historic Center Loop: Start at Piazza Alfieri, visit the Cathedral, San Secondo Church, and Troyana Tower, then stroll through the Jewish Ghetto.
- Roman Route: Begin at the Red Tower, follow Via Carducci to see Roman ruins, then visit the Archaeological Museum.
- Art and Architecture Walk: Explore the palaces of Malabaila and Roero, visit Palazzo Mazzetti, and admire the Gothic architecture of the Cathedral.
- Park and Garden Stroll: Walk through Parco della Resistenza, then visit Giardini Pubblici for a relaxing break.
According to walking tour guides, these routes offer a mix of history, art, and nature, providing a comprehensive overview of Asti.
